Your Dog’s Stairway to Heaven: A Buying Guide for Lift Harnesses
Stairs can become tricky for older dogs, dogs recovering from surgery, or those with mobility issues. A dog lift harness can make life much easier for both you and your furry friend. This guide helps you choose the best one.
Key Features to Look For
When shopping for a dog lift harness, several features make a big difference in safety and ease of use.
- Support Location: Some harnesses support the hindquarters only. Others offer full-body support (front and back). Full support is best for dogs that cannot bear weight at all. Hind-only support works well for dogs who need help climbing or descending stairs but can still use their front legs.
- Handle Design: Look for strong, comfortable handles. Padded handles prevent your hand from getting sore when lifting a heavier dog. Some harnesses have a single handle, while others offer dual handles for better control and leverage, especially on steep stairs.
- Ease of Use: The harness should be easy to put on and take off quickly. You do not want to wrestle with complicated buckles when your dog needs immediate help.
- Weight Capacity: Check the maximum weight the harness is designed to safely support. Never exceed this limit.
Important Materials Matter
The material determines durability and your dog’s comfort. Good materials last longer and feel better against your dog’s fur.
Durability and Comfort
- Nylon Webbing: Strong nylon webbing forms the main straps. It resists tearing and handles heavy lifting well.
- Padding/Lining: Soft, breathable fabrics like neoprene or thick mesh should line the parts touching your dog’s belly and chest. This padding prevents chafing and keeps the dog cool.
- Stitching Quality: Examine the stitching around the handles and connection points. Heavy-duty, reinforced stitching shows that the manufacturer built the harness for real work. Poor stitching reduces the harness’s quality significantly.
Factors That Improve or Reduce Quality
The design choices greatly impact how well the harness works in real life.
What Makes a Harness Great?
A high-quality harness features wide straps that distribute the dog’s weight evenly across the body. This prevents pressure points that could cause pain. Adjustable straps are crucial; you must be able to customize the fit snugly so the harness does not slip during a lift.
What to Avoid?
Avoid harnesses made with thin, flimsy straps or plastic buckles. Cheap plastic buckles can snap under stress. Also, be wary of harnesses that require a lot of complicated threading or adjusting every time you use them. These designs frustrate users and waste time.
User Experience and Use Cases
Think about when and how you will use the harness most often.
For daily use, such as getting up the porch steps, a simple, quick-fastening hind-support sling is often perfect. If your dog is recovering from hip surgery and needs total assistance getting in and out of the car, a full-body harness offers better security and control.
User reviews often highlight how easy it is to manage the harness one-handed. If you are holding a leash or opening a door, one-handed operation is a major plus. A good harness should feel secure to the handler but comfortable enough that the dog wears it without fuss when needed.
10 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) About Dog Lift Harnesses
Q: Can I leave the harness on my dog all the time?
A: Generally, no. Most lift harnesses are designed for temporary assistance, not continuous wear like a walking harness. Leaving it on can restrict movement or cause skin irritation.
Q: How do I measure my dog for the correct size?
A: You usually measure around your dog’s chest/girth (the widest part behind the front legs) and sometimes the length from the front of the chest to the rear end. Always follow the specific brand’s sizing chart.
Q: Are these harnesses safe for puppies?
A: They are usually designed for adult or senior dogs who have lost mobility. Puppies are still growing, and these harnesses might interfere with their natural bone and muscle development.
Q: What is the difference between a sling and a harness?
A: A sling is typically a simple strap that goes under the belly, offering temporary support. A full harness wraps around the chest and/or rear end, offering more comprehensive, secure support for difficult climbs.
Q: How much weight can these harnesses safely hold?
A: This varies greatly. Small dog slings might hold 20 lbs, while heavy-duty harnesses for large breeds can safely support 150 lbs or more. Check the product specifications carefully.
Q: Should I buy a front or rear support harness?
A: Buy a rear support harness if your dog can still use its front legs well. Buy a full-body harness if the dog has weakness in all four limbs or severe balance issues.
Q: Are they machine washable?
A: Many nylon and mesh harnesses are machine washable on a gentle cycle, but always check the care instructions. Air drying is often recommended to preserve the strap integrity.
Q: What if my dog is very sensitive or has thin skin?
A: Look specifically for harnesses labeled as having “extra padding” or made with soft neoprene lining to prevent rubbing and irritation.
Q: Can I use this harness with my dog’s regular leash?
A: Yes, most harnesses have a D-ring attachment point where you can clip your standard leash for walking *before* or *after* using the lift handles.
Q: How quickly should I be able to put it on?
A: For emergency help or quick trips outside, it should take less than 30 seconds to secure the harness properly.
